WebApr 4, 2024 · A trans person can change their legal sex by obtaining a Gender Recognition Certificate through procedures set out in the Gender Recognition Act 2004. A trans person who does not have a Gender Recognition Certificate retains the sex recorded on their birth certificate for legal purposes.
WebFeb 23, 2024 · In the Equality Act, gender reassignment means proposing to undergo, undergoing or having undergone a process to reassign your sex.
